Compare all specifications:
1993 Chevrolet Camaro | 1999 Toyota Yaris | |
Make | Chevrolet | Toyota |
Model | Camaro | Yaris |
Year Released | 1993 | 1999 |
Body Type | Coupe | Hatchback |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 3392 cc | 1364 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 2 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 158 HP | 84 HP |
Engine RPM | 4600 RPM | 6000 RPM |
Torque | 271 Nm | 131 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3600 RPM | 4100 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 92 mm | 75 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 84 mm | 73.5 mm |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Rear |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 4 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 3 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1413 kg | 965 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4910 mm | 3620 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1890 mm | 1670 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1310 mm | 1510 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2450 mm | 2380 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 68 L | 45 L |
